首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

django ajax继续追加相同的结果

Django是一个基于Python的开源Web应用框架,它提供了一套完整的工具和库,用于快速开发高效、安全和可扩展的Web应用程序。Ajax(Asynchronous JavaScript and XML)是一种用于在Web应用中实现异步通信的技术,它可以在不刷新整个页面的情况下,通过与服务器进行数据交换,实现动态更新页面内容。

在Django中使用Ajax可以实现动态加载数据,而不需要刷新整个页面。当需要追加相同的结果时,可以通过Ajax发送请求,获取数据,并将数据追加到页面中。

以下是使用Django和Ajax实现追加相同结果的步骤:

  1. 在前端页面中,使用JavaScript编写Ajax请求的代码。可以使用原生JavaScript或者jQuery等库来简化操作。通过Ajax请求后端接口获取数据。
  2. 在Django中,创建一个视图函数来处理Ajax请求。该视图函数需要返回需要追加的数据。
  3. 在Django的URL配置中,将该视图函数与一个URL路径进行绑定。
  4. 在前端页面中,通过JavaScript监听某个事件(比如按钮点击),当事件触发时,执行Ajax请求。
  5. 在Ajax请求的回调函数中,获取到后端返回的数据,并将数据追加到页面中的相应位置。

通过以上步骤,就可以实现在Django中使用Ajax来追加相同的结果。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。产品介绍链接
  2. 云数据库MySQL版:提供高性能、可扩展的MySQL数据库服务。产品介绍链接
  3. 云存储(COS):提供安全可靠的对象存储服务,适用于存储和处理各种类型的数据。产品介绍链接

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券